As of Q2'26, LRCX's latest data shows ROE at 15.71%, ROA at 7.45%, and ROIC at 9.86%. These figures represent the company's most recent profitability and capital efficiency metrics, reflecting performance up to the quarter ending 2025-12-28. From Q3'23 to Q2'26, all three metrics—ROE, ROA, and ROIC—demonstrate a clear upward trend, with notable acceleration beginning in Q3'25. ROE increased from 9.68% to a peak of 17.44% in Q4'25 before settling at 15.71%, while ROA rose from 4.23% to a high of 8.06% in Q4'25 and then slightly moderated. ROIC followed a similar pattern, peaking at 10.84% in Q4'25. This trend suggests improving operational efficiency and profitability, particularly in the latter half of the period, despite some minor pullbacks after the Q4'25 highs.
